The Affinity 3 Waterfowl Elite is primarily designed for waterfowl hunting, but its versatility makes it a viable option for turkey hunting as well. It shares the same reliable Inertia Driven® system as the Affinity 3.5, but with some key differences.
To use the Affinity 3 Waterfowl Elite for turkey hunting, you’ll need to swap out the choke tube for a tighter constriction turkey choke. REI Expert Advice (rei.com/learn/expert-advice/shotgun-chokes.html) has a great explanation of choke tube constriction and how it affects patterns.

| Feature | Franchi Affinity 3.5 Turkey | Franchi Affinity 3 Waterfowl Elite |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Use | Turkey Hunting | Waterfowl Hunting (Versatile) |
| Barrel Length | Typically 26" | Typically 28" or longer |
| Camo Options | Mossy Oak, Realtree | Waterfowl-Specific Camo |
| Choke Tube | Extended Turkey Choke Included | Waterfowl Choke (Requires Turkey Choke Swap) |
| Recoil | Low | Low |
